OAuth2 Proxy - Authentication Bypass

Published: April 14, 2026Updated: April 14, 2026Remote Exploitable

Overview

OAuth2 Proxy < 7.15.2 contains an authentication bypass caused by misconfiguration with auth_request-style integration and enabled --ping-user-agent or --gcp-healthchecks, letting unauthenticated remote attackers access protected resources.

Severity & Score

Severity: Critical
CVSS Score: 9.1

Impact

Unauthenticated remote attackers can bypass authentication to access protected upstream resources.

Mitigation

Upgrade to version 7.15.2 or later.
